Retrospect and prospect: a visual analysis of artificial intelligence applications in neurorehabilitation
View through CrossRef
Abstract
Objective
To explore the current research status and future development trend of artificial intelligence in neurorehabilitation.
Methods
To collect and organize the literature on AI in neurorehabilitation from the core collection of Web of Science (WOS) database in the past ten years, and summarize the current status and predict the future development trend of AI in neurorehabilitation by using VOSviewer software and CiteSpace software in Java language environment.
Results
A total of 326 documents were retrieved, with the highest number of publications in 2014 (81); the scholars with the most publications were LiChong and PanYu (6); the institution with the most publications was Tsinghua University (8); the journal with the most publications was Sensors (26); and the number of Chinese research in the field of AI applied to neurorehabilitation is leading in the world. The keyword analysis shows that the research hotspots of AI applied to neurorehabilitation in recent years are mainly in brain-computer interface, deep learning, and robotics.
Conclusion
Recently, artificial intelligence in neurorehabilitation has developed rapidly, and the number of papers has increased year by year, mainly focusing on brain-computer interface, deep learning, and robotics.
